数据库服务器是用于存储、管理和检索数据的软件系统,它们在现代计算机系统中扮演着至关重要的角色。以下是一些主流的数据库服务器:
关系型数据库服务器 :MySQL:
适用于各种规模的应用和网站,从小型个人项目到大型企业级应用都有广泛应用。
Oracle:功能强大的商业关系型数据库管理系统,适用于大规模企业级应用,具有高度可靠性、安全性和可扩展性。
Microsoft SQL Server:微软开发的关系型数据库管理系统,适用于Windows操作系统,具有良好的集成性和易用性。
PostgreSQL:开源的对象-关系型数据库系统,以其丰富的功能和扩展性闻名。
SQLite:轻量级的关系型数据库,适用于小型应用。
MariaDB:MySQL的一个分支,兼容性好,易于维护。
DB2:IBM开发的关系型数据库管理系统,适用于大型企业级应用。
非关系型数据库服务器 :MongoDB:
一个流行的文档型数据库,适用于需要灵活数据模型的应用程序。
Redis:内存中的数据结构存储系统,用作数据库、缓存和消息代理。
Cassandra:高度可扩展的分布式数据库,适用于处理大量数据。
数据仓库服务器 :Amazon Redshift:
亚马逊提供的完全托管的数据仓库服务。
Google BigQuery:谷歌提供的云数据仓库服务。
Microsoft Azure Synapse Analytics:微软提供的数据仓库和分析服务。
Snowflake:提供云数据仓库服务的平台。
IBM Db2 Warehouse:IBM提供的数据仓库解决方案。
Oracle Autonomous Data Warehouse:Oracle提供的自主数据仓库服务。
SAP Data Warehouse Cloud:SAP提供的云数据仓库服务。
Teradata Vantage:Teradata提供的数据仓库解决方案。
数据库服务器通常提供丰富的管理工具,如MySQL Workbench,用于数据库设计、SQL开发和服务器管理。它们为客户应用程序提供数据服务,建立在数据库系统基础上,并具有数据库系统的特性。